Reviewers largely see Google Fonts as a practical, easy-to-use font library that helps teams move faster on web and design work. They praise simple website implementation, broad free commercial use, and a large selection that keeps improving, with some noting options to optimize loading and reduce strain on their own servers. The main caveat is sameness: because it is so widely used, some reviewers think it can weaken distinctive branding. One user also avoids embedding it on websites over privacy concerns, and offline use can require extra setup.
